The Manufacturing of Alcohols From Sugar Walking Stick

Transforming sugar Cane right into liquors showcases the adaptability of this exotic crop. The fermentation of sugar Cane juice or molasses leads to a series of preferred beverages, consisting of rum, cachaça, and aguardiente. These beverages are deeply rooted in the cultures of sugar-producing areas, particularly in the Caribbean and South America.

The production process begins with the removal of juice from newly harvested sugar walking cane, which is after that fermented using yeast. This fermentation transforms the sugars right into alcohol, creating a base that can be distilled for greater alcohol web content. Distillation strategies vary, affecting the taste profiles and qualities of the end product.

Furthermore, aging in barrels can boost the intricacy and depth of flavors in spirits like rum. Sugar Cane and Its Usage in Biodegradable Product Packaging

Sugar cane's convenience extends past drink manufacturing to cutting-edge applications in naturally degradable product packaging. This sustainable source is increasingly being used to produce eco-friendly product packaging remedies that minimize reliance on petroleum-based plastics. Acquired from the fibrous residue of sugar walking stick, known as bagasse, suppliers can create eco-friendly products that break down quicker than typical plastics.

These sugar cane-based packaging items provide a sustainable option for various markets, including food and durable goods. They not just lessen environmental influence however also line up with the growing consumer demand for lasting techniques. In addition, sugar Cane product packaging can be crafted to keep longevity while being lightweight, ensuring that it fulfills the functional needs of services.
